Description
Stories We Tell Ourselves is a marvelous inquiry into what dreams can tell us about ourselves-in short, that some vast part of our experience, cut off from us and made unconscious, can be plumbed by anyone who is curious and persistent enough to pursue the enigmatic language of dreams.-Annie Rogers, author, The Unsayable: The Hidden Language of Trauma
